SYRACUSE -- Syracuse is getting another American Basketball Association franchise.
ABA CEO Joe Newman says the team will be called the Syracuse ShockWave and will begin play in 2010.
The owner is Charles Iavarone, who's currently serving a combat tour in Iraq and is due back in the United States in September.
This will be the league's second attempt since 2007 to place a team in Syracuse. Two years ago, the Syracuse Raging Bullz lasted six games. Its failure was blamed on the owner's inability to gauge the Syracuse market.
